README.md

    VOX TOOLSET

    Download

    This is an addon that I’ve abandoned, and I don’t want to develop it further. If you find it useful, take it.

    Description

    Primary information

    Vox is an add-on for Blender which can be used as a voxel editor or tile map generator.

    Example as a voxel editor:

    Example

    Example as a world generator:

    Example as a world generator

    Using tile sets, not only can you build houses in different shapes and variations, but also apply colors and geometry nodes effects. Example tile sets:

    Example tile sets

    3 new tools will be added into edit mode:

    3 new tools

    Add voxels, Paint voxels and remove voxels.

    Add voxels

    Add voxels

    Modes:

    • Default — draw a voxel or a rectangle.

    • Draw and extrude — draw a point or a rectangle and extrude at second mouse click

    Alt — pick a color from voxel

    Ctrl — remove voxels

    Draw voxels

    Draw voxels

    Modes:

    • Brush — draw color or tile set inside a sphere with given radius

    • Per voxel — draw color or tile set of one voxel

    Switcher — draw color or change tile set

    Strength, falloff and Spacing -similar to regular graphic settings.

    Accumulate not yet implemented

    Alt — pick a color from voxel

    Vox panel

    Vox panel

    Define is object is in tile set or uses tile sets to build the big model.

    Use as voxel

    Use as voxel

    Layer above, Same Layer, Layer Below — define basic rules, where this tile used. For example, if you define Same layer front as «Empty or Other» this tile will be set only if there is no voxel in front of this tile.

    To help you identify which button is front, left or right, all changes indicates in 3D-view:

    Preview settings

    Use custom weight — Tiles with more count of rules have more weight, and tile with maximum weight and passed all rules will be selected. In some cases, you can set custom weight.

    Random Probability — If several tiles with same weight can be putted in same spot, they selected randomly. You can add some probability here to make some tile appears more often.

    Allow rotation — allow rotating tile in 90 degrees.

    Only on the ground level — this tile can be used only if z equals 0

    Only on even — this tile can be used only if x y or z coordinate is

    Current limitations

    Minimum requared verison is Blender 3.1

    If scale rotation or transform is not default, Vox is not very accurate, I recommend using applied transform.

    To use color in models, Vox uses «Realize Instances». If you have troubles with performance with high poly tiles — consider using switchers:

    c5cae5c5cba3c0f3f84ffc59f421f62ba18b4e2d.jpg

    Simple box — Replaces all models by boxes only in viewport

    Simple Instances — Disables Realize Instances — colors is ignored. In viewport in render.

    To use color information in tiles, use Attribute Col, not a Vertex color node:

    53ea5ac3196a33158d8e66dd33757c43117b5c91.jpg

    To use a UV map, use Attribute node instead regular UV map nodes:

    6e78ed1694ac989fef4a11ebccf394d4cb5cc149.jpg

    Описание

    Voxel editor for Blender

    Конвейеры
    0 успешных
    0 с ошибкой